関数リファレンス

本節では、コード生成が出力するAPI関数について、次の記述フォーマットに従って説明します。

 

図3.1 API関数の記述フォーマット

 

(1)           名称
API
関数の名称を示しています。

(2)           機能
API
関数の機能概要を示しています。

(3)           [指定形式]
API
関数を C 言語で呼び出す際の記述形式を示しています。

(4)           [引数]
API
関数の引数を次の形式で示しています。

I/O

引数

説明

(a)

(b)

(c)

(a)      I/O

          引数の種類

          I         …   入力引数

          O       …   出力引数

(b)      引数

          引数のデータタイプ

(c)      説明

          引数の説明

(5)           [戻り値]
API
関数からの戻り値を次の形式で示しています。

マクロ

説明

(a)

(b)

(a)      マクロ

          戻り値のマクロ

(b)      説明

          戻り値の説明

More:

共  通

クロック発生回路

電圧検出回路(LVD)

クロック周波数精度測定回路(CAC)

消費電力低減機能

割り込みコントローラ(ICU)

バ  ス

DMA コントローラ(DMAC)

データ・トランスファ・コントローラ(DTC)

イベント・リンク・コントローラ(ELC)

I/Oポート

マルチファンクション・タイマ・パルス・ユニット2(MTU2)

マルチファンクション・タイマ・パルス・ユニット3(MTU3)

ポート・アウトプット・イネーブル2(POE2)

ポート・アウトプット・イネーブル3(POE3)

汎用PWMタイマ(GPT)

16ビットタイマ・パルス・ユニット(TPU)

8 ビットタイマ・パルス・ユニット(TMR)

プログラマブル・パルスジェネレータ(PPG)

コンペア・マッチ・タイマ(CMT)

コンペア・マッチ・タイマW(CMTW)

リアルタイム・クロック(RTC)

ウォッチドッグ・タイマ(WDT)

独立ウォッチドッグ・タイマ(IWDT)

シリアル・コミュニケーション・インタフェース(SCI)

FIFO内蔵シリアル・コミュニケーション・インタフェース(SCIFA)

I2Cバス・インタフェース(RIIC)

シリアル・ペリフェラル・インタフェース(RSPI)

CRC 演算器(CRC)

12ビットA/Dコンバータ(S12AD)

D/A コンバータ(DA)

12ビットD/A コンバータ(R12DA)

コンパレータB(CMPB)

データ演算回路(DOC)

ローパワータイマ(LPT)

コンパレータC(CMPC)

LCDコントローラ / ドライバ(LCD)